Bambu Lab PLA Matte in Grass Green is a 1 kg matte-finish filament with spool for everyday 3D printing, especially for users who want a softer, less reflective surface straight off the printer. It suits beginners, hobby makers, classrooms, and design prototyping thanks to its easy-print behaviour and AMS compatibility. Its main limitation is that matte PLA is better for visual finish than for applications needing higher heat or impact resistance.
Best suited to appearance-focused PLA printing; for parts that need stronger heat tolerance, durability, or engineering-grade performance, a specialist filament will be a better choice.
Combines an elegant matte surface finish with easy-print PLA behaviour and AMS series compatibility.
Compatible with Bambu Lab AMS Series and suitable for 3D printers that use 1.75 mm PLA filament.
A: Yes, it is a 1.75mm PLA filament with a stated diameter tolerance of plus or minus 0.03mm, which suits many FDM printers that accept 1.75mm material. It will not suit printers designed for 2.85mm or 3.00mm filament.
A: This version includes the spool, so it is ready to load without transferring filament first. That is useful if you do not already have a reusable Bambu Lab spool, while refill versions are meant for users who already have one on hand.
A: A matte PLA finish gives printed parts a flatter, less shiny surface that can make layer lines look less obvious. It is better suited to display pieces and prototypes where appearance matters more than a glossy decorative finish.
A: Yes, the scraped specs list it as compatible with all AMS series units. That makes it a suitable option for automatic material loading in supported Bambu Lab setups, provided your printer is configured for 1.75mm PLA filament.
A: Yes, the product is described as having low indoor printing emissions and is certified to UL GREENGUARD 2904. It is still sensible to print in a well-ventilated area, especially during long jobs or when printing in smaller rooms.
A: This spool contains 1kg of filament, which is the common full-size roll for regular desktop 3D printing. It suits multiple small parts or several medium prints, but large models with dense infill will use the roll more quickly.
